Westchester County closes multiple beaches due to rainfall

The Westchester County Health Department has announced the temporary closure of several beaches in New Rochelle, Mamaroneck, and Rye due to recent rainfall. The decision comes after 0.67 inches of rain fell over the last 24 hours.

In New Rochelle, Hudson Park Beach, Davenport Beach Club, Greentree Country Club, and Surf Club on the Sound are affected. In Mamaroneck, Harbor Island Park, Beach Point Club, Orienta Beach Club, and Mamaroneck Beach and Yacht Club are closed. Additionally, Coveleigh Club in Rye is also shut.

The closures are a precautionary measure against bacterial contamination caused by road runoff into drainage outfalls near these beaches. The health department advises beachgoers to avoid water activities at these locations today. The beaches may reopen tomorrow if conditions improve.

“The County remains committed to maintaining high standards of environmental health and safety across its recreational facilities.”
